Michael,

One good reason for adding a product to multiple categories is if a particular product falls into two categories, and you want to make sure a customer finds it. On my site I sell speakers that go on wakeboarding boats and I sell lights that also go on them. I have another product that is a combination of speakers AND lights. I would love to add the product to both categories so that if a customer is looking at the lights they will see it, and if they are looking at the speakers they will see it.
